The power of Java RESTful API: Control the web, automate processes
Written by php editor Apple, this article will introduce the powerful functions of Java combined with RESTful API to control the Web and automate processes. RESTful API provides Java applications with a convenient way to communicate with web services, automating processes and improving user experience. This article will take an in-depth look at how Java uses RESTful APIs to control the functionality of web applications and how to automate the process to help developers better utilize this powerful tool.
- Create and manipulate web resources: RESTful api Allows applications to create, read, update and delete WEB resources such as user accounts, product details or order.
- Resource status management: The RESTful API uses Http status codes to indicate the status of the resource, such as 200 (OK), 404 (Not Found) or 500 (Internal Server Error).
- Flexible data representation formats: RESTful APIs can return data in multiple formats, such as JSON, XML, or plain text, chosen based on the client's request or server configuration.
Automated process
- Task Automation: The RESTful API can be used to automate common tasks such as creating users, sending emails, or processing payments. This saves time and improves accuracy.
- Service Integration: RESTful API allows communication between different applications and services, such as CRM systems and order management systems. This integrates processes and increases efficiency.
- Mobile Application Support: The RESTful API is designed for applications on mobile devices to access data and services, enabling instant and seamless interactions.
Other benefits
- Scalability: The RESTful API is easily extensible to support more resources and functionality, allowing applications to grow over time.
- Security: The RESTful API supports secure protocols such as TLS/SSL to protect data and communications.
- Cache optimization: RESTful API complies with the HTTP caching mechanism, which can reduce repeated requests and improve performance.
- Platform agnostic: RESTful APIs can be written and deployed using any platform that supports HTTP, including Java, python, node.js and C#.
developers can create powerful web applications and services with the ability to control web resources, automate processes, and provide a seamless user experience. This architecture’s flexibility, scalability, and security features make it ideal for modern web development.
The above is the detailed content of The power of Java RESTful API: Control the web, automate processes. For more information, please follow other related articles on the PHP Chinese website!

Hot AI Tools

Undresser.AI Undress
AI-powered app for creating realistic nude photos

AI Clothes Remover
Online AI tool for removing clothes from photos.

Undress AI Tool
Undress images for free

Clothoff.io
AI clothes remover

AI Hentai Generator
Generate AI Hentai for free.

Hot Article

Hot Tools

Notepad++7.3.1
Easy-to-use and free code editor

SublimeText3 Chinese version
Chinese version, very easy to use

Zend Studio 13.0.1
Powerful PHP integrated development environment

Dreamweaver CS6
Visual web development tools

SublimeText3 Mac version
God-level code editing software (SublimeText3)

Hot Topics



With the popularity of digital asset trading, it is crucial to choose a reliable currency trading app. This article introduces the top ten applications around the world, including well-known platforms such as Binance, Coinbase, Kraken and FTX. These applications offer different advantages to meet the needs of beginners, experienced traders and cryptocurrency enthusiasts. When choosing, consider security, transaction fees, asset selection, interface and customer support to find the platform that suits your needs.

Why can’t the Bybit exchange link be directly downloaded and installed? Bybit is a cryptocurrency exchange that provides trading services to users. The exchange's mobile apps cannot be downloaded directly through AppStore or GooglePlay for the following reasons: 1. App Store policy restricts Apple and Google from having strict requirements on the types of applications allowed in the app store. Cryptocurrency exchange applications often do not meet these requirements because they involve financial services and require specific regulations and security standards. 2. Laws and regulations Compliance In many countries, activities related to cryptocurrency transactions are regulated or restricted. To comply with these regulations, Bybit Application can only be used through official websites or other authorized channels

Sesame Exchange is a cross-border e-commerce platform that connects buyers and sellers around the world and provides a wide range of goods and services. After downloading the application, users register an account to browse and purchase products. The platform provides a variety of payment methods, and users can view order status and contact sellers. If you have any return request, you need to contact the seller to submit a return application. To ensure safety, be sure to protect personal information, pay attention to suspicious emails, and use secure payment methods.

Gate.io, the leading cryptocurrency exchange, has now released its latest version of its mobile app. The app provides a convenient downloading path, allowing users to install it through the Google Play Store or the official Gate.io website. Whether it is an Android or iOS device, users can easily find and install it by simply searching for "Gate.io". The installation process of the application is simple and clear, just click the "Install" or "Get" button to complete.

Gate.io Exchange provides users with an official login portal. Through the official website or mobile app, users can log in to their account. The login steps are easy, including entering the email or mobile phone number used when registering, as well as your password. In order to ensure the security of the account, it is recommended that users change their passwords regularly and properly keep their login information. In addition, the article also provides solutions to common login problems, including inability to log in and password loss.

The official website of Gate.io can be accessed by clicking on the link or entering the URL in the browser. It is recommended to add the URL to a bookmark or favorite for easy access. If you encounter inaccessible issues, try clearing the browser's cache and cookies. Be careful to prevent phishing, the official website of Gate.io will not take the initiative to ask for personal information. In addition, Gate.io provides mobile applications that can be found through the app provider

It is crucial to choose a formal channel to download the app and ensure the safety of your account.

Gate.io, a leading cryptocurrency trading platform founded in 2013, provides Chinese users with a complete official Chinese website. The website provides a wide range of services, including spot trading, futures trading and lending, and provides special features such as Chinese interface, rich resources and community support.
